Game Boy Micro only supports Game Boy Advance games. With the Game Boy Advance SP you can play Game Boy, Game Boy Color, and Game Boy Advance games. Also, not all Game Boy Advance accessories work with the Game Boy Micro.

Sega Mega Drive. By far gets the most usage out of all my old consoles. N64 gets a decent run with goldeneye and mario kart, but boozy 4 player shared controller micro machines never disappoints. Mortal Kombat 1-3, SF2 are big hits too.
Master system has good retro appeal, but isn't as genuinely fun as the others. SNES is ok, but doesn't have as many good multiplayer games. Original xbox is good, modded with heaps of emulators, but it's just not the same without the right shaped controller. xbox games are a little too new to have any retro charm, though operation desert storm 2 rocks. Old gaming nights are fun, and invariably 3 thing happen - epic micro machines til 3am, 2 player coop NBA Jam til well past dawn and a playthrough of ninja turtles. Also, the old segas are really easy to mod for AV outputs. |
